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) Increased Demand Update (ICN 2790)

Important Customer Notice Product Update

Ref: 2025 / 2790 ICN Number: 2790

  • The NHS is facing increased demand for PPE products due to rising cases of respiratory viral infections, including RSV, influenza, and COVID.
  • This has led to local decisions to raise orders for exceptionally high quantities of PPE products for use across hospitals and community settings.
  • We are also hearing that some trusts are now running low on push stock, leading to an increase in PPE demand.
  • Whilst we have increased stock levels to account for seasonal changes, we are experiencing demand beyond normal winter patterns.
  • As a precautionary measure to ensure continuity of supply across all trusts, some products may need to be placed on demand management.

Customer action required

To help us manage demand effectively and plan deliveries during this time, please follow our guidelines.

Demand Management Guidelines:

No increase in demand

  • Order quantity thresholds have been set to meet your usual winter demand.
  • Place consistent daily orders to ensure you receive your maximum daily allocation.
  • If your allocation is insufficient, please contact Customer Services who can submit a demand management escalation on your behalf for your threshold to be reviewed and/or an injection of stock sent.

Increase in demand

  • If you anticipate needing significantly more than your usual winter quantities, you must tell us before placing the order. Please complete a demand capture form and submit to:
  • This will help us adjust your daily threshold accordingly. Once received, the detail will be input into our database, and you will receive written confirmation that it has been done.

Latest updates:

  • Type IIR and FFP3 face masks have been placed on demand management.
  • If your preferred Type IIR mask is unavailable, please order a direct alternative.
  • BWM85057 and BWM85003 are also nationally available Type IIR alternatives for consideration.
  • If your preferred FFP3 masks is unavailable, alternative products are available but users of FFP3 masks are required to be FIT tested for using the specific make and model of respirator facemask. Guidance should be adhered to for use of alternative FFP3 masks.
